Money market yield (also known as CD equivalent yield) is the annualized HPY on the basis of a 360-day year using simple interest. Example An investor buys a $1,000 face-value T-bill due in 60 days at a price of $990. Bank discount yield: (1000 - 990)/1000 x 360/60 = 6%. Holding period yield: (1000 - 990)/990 = 1.0101%.F) You read in The Wall Street Journal that 30-day T-bills are currently yielding 4.8%. T-bills are issued at a discount and are redeemed at par. Auctions. While 14-day and 91-day T-bills are auctioned every week on Fridays, 182-day and 364-day T-bills are auctioned every alternate week on Wednesdays. Net 30 terms are often coupled with a discount for early payment to encourage the client to pay more quickly. For example, small business owners will often offer net 30 terms with a 2 percent payment discount if the client offers a full payment within 10 days. On contracts and invoices, you’ll see these terms written out as “2/10 net 30.”.Summary. Change value during the period between open outcry settle and the commencement of the next day's trading is calculated as ...Sep 14, 2021 · The Treasury auctions T-bills to investors, who purchase the security at a discount to the face value. For example, an investor may purchase a bill with a $1,000 face value and a six-month maturity at a price of $950. In six months, when the investment matures, the investor receives $1,000, producing $50 in profit.
